سبد دانلود 0

تگ های موضوع ایجاد سایت برنامه جدول تناوبی

ایجاد سایت برنامه جدول تناوبی: راهنمای جامع و کامل


در دنیای علم و فناوری، ساختن یک سایت برنامه جدول تناوبی نه تنها یک پروژه جذاب بلکه نیازمند طراحی دقیق، برنامه‌ریزی استراتژیک و دانش فنی عمیق است. این پروژه، یعنی توسعه یک سایت تعاملی برای نمایش و آموزش جدول تناوبی عناصر، می‌تواند نقش مهمی در آموزش دانش‌آموزان و دانشجویان، و حتی پژوهشگران داشته باشد. در ادامه، به صورت جامع و با جزئیات کامل، روند ایجاد چنین سایتی را شرح می‌دهیم، از مفاهیم اولیه گرفته تا نکات فنی و طراحی.
پروسه ساخت سایت جدول تناوبی، نیازمند درک کامل مفهوم جدول، عناصر آن، نحوه نمایش، و امکانات تعاملی است. بنابراین، در ابتدا باید به شناخت کامل محتوا و اهداف مورد نظر بپردازیم. بعد، وارد مرحله طراحی رابط کاربری و توسعه برنامه می‌شویم، و در نهایت، آزمایش و بهبودهای لازم را انجام می‌دهیم.
مرحله اول: شناخت محتوا و تعیین اهداف
قبل از شروع توسعه، باید دقیق بدانید چه چیزی می‌خواهید ارائه دهید. آیا هدف صرفاً نمایش جدول است یا قصد دارید امکانات تعاملی، مانند جستجو، فیلتر، و توضیحات جامع درباره هر عنصر را داشته باشید؟ در این مرحله، باید محتواهای آموزشی، تصاویر، و داده‌های مربوط به عناصر را جمع‌آوری کنید. برای مثال، شامل نام عنصر، نماد، عدد اتمی، وزن اتمی، حالت فیزیکی، و ویژگی‌های دیگر باشد.
همچنین، باید تصمیم بگیرید که کدام فناوری‌ها و ابزارهای برنامه‌نویسی برای توسعه سایت استفاده می‌شود. مثلا، زبان‌های برنامه‌نویسی مانند HTML، CSS، JavaScript، و فریم‌ورک‌های مربوطه، گزینه‌های محبوب هستند. همچنین، اگر قصد دارید سایت را داینامیک و قابل بروزرسانی کنید، ممکن است نیاز داشته باشید از پایگاه داده‌ها بهره ببرید.
مرحله دوم: طراحی رابط کاربری و تجربه کاربری
در طراحی، تمرکز بر سادگی، جذابیت و قابلیت‌های تعاملی مهم است. باید یک طراحی واکنش‌گرا و قابل دسترس در نظر گرفته شود، به طوری که کاربر بتواند به راحتی عناصر مختلف را مشاهده و با آن‌ها تعامل برقرار کند. طراحی باید شامل بخش‌های زیر باشد:
- نوار منو یا هدر برای ناوبری آسان
- صفحه اصلی با نمایش جدول کامل یا بخش‌های جداگانه
- بخش جستجو و فیلتر کردن عناصر
- پنجره‌های توضیحات هنگام کلیک بر روی عناصر
- بخش آموزش و توضیحات جامع برای هر عنصر
در این مرحله، می‌توانید از ابزارهای طراحی گرافیکی مانند Adobe XD یا Figma بهره ببرید تا نمونه اولیه رابط کاربری خود را بسازید و قبل از پیاده‌سازی، بازخورد دریافت کنید.
مرحله سوم: توسعه و برنامه‌نویسی سایت
حالا نوبت به نوشتن کد و پیاده‌سازی است. ابتدا، ساختار HTML برای ساختاردهی عناصر صفحه، اهمیت دارد. در ادامه، با CSS ظاهر و استایل صفحه را طراحی می‌کنید، تا جذابیت و خوانایی بالا رود. سپس، با JavaScript، قابلیت‌های تعاملی مانند جستجو، فیلتر، و نمایش اطلاعات جزئی را به سایت اضافه می‌کنید.
برای مثال، می‌توانید از کتابخانه‌هایی مانند React یا Vue.js استفاده کنید تا پروژه‌تان ساختار منسجم‌تری داشته باشد و راحت‌تر مدیریت شود. همچنین، برای بخش داده‌ها، می‌توانید فایل‌های JSON یا پایگاه داده‌های کوچک مثل Firebase را به کار ببرید تا اطلاعات عناصر را ذخیره و مدیریت کنید.
در این مرحله، باید توجه کنید که عملکرد سایت سریع و بدون خطا باشد. بنابراین، کدهای خود را با دقت آزمایش کنید و از ابزارهای دیباگ بهره ببرید.
مرحله چهارم: افزودن امکانات تعاملی و آموزش
در این مرحله، امکانات پیشرفته‌تر را اضافه می‌کنید. مثلا، می‌توانید بخش‌هایی برای آموزش و توضیحات تفصیلی درباره هر عنصر طراحی کنید. همچنین، می‌توانید قابلیت‌های مقایسه عناصر، ارائه نمودارهای تصویری، و لینک‌دهی به مطالب مرتبط را پیاده‌سازی کنید.
علاوه بر این، بخش‌های تعاملی مانند آزمون‌های کوتاه، بازی‌های آموزشی، و سوالات چندگزینه‌ای می‌تواند به یادگیری بهتر کمک کند. همه این امکانات، با هدف جذب کاربر، و ایجاد تجربه کاربری متمایز و مفید، طراحی و توسعه می‌شوند.
مرحله پنجم: آزمایش و بهبودهای نهایی
پس از اتمام توسعه، باید سایت را به صورت کامل آزمایش کنید. این شامل تست بر روی مرورگرهای مختلف، دستگاه‌های متفاوت، و بررسی کارایی است. از بازخورد کاربران بهره ببرید و ایرادات را رفع کنید. این کار، تضمین می‌کند سایت شما آماده بهره‌برداری عمومی است و بدون مشکل است.
در این مرحله، هم‌چنین، امنیت سایت، به‌روزرسانی محتوا و بهینه‌سازی سرعت بارگذاری، باید مورد توجه قرار گیرد. استفاده از CDN، فشرده‌سازی تصاویر، و به‌کارگیری روش‌های امنیتی، نقش مهمی در بهبود عملکرد دارند.
نتیجه‌گیری: اهمیت و تأثیر ساخت سایت جدول تناوبی
در مجموع، ساختن یک سایت برنامه جدول تناوبی، فرآیندی است که نیازمند دقت، دانش فنی، و خلاقیت است. این پروژه، نه تنها به آموزش کمک می‌کند، بلکه فرصت خوبی برای توسعه مهارت‌های برنامه‌نویسی و طراحی است. با استفاده از فناوری‌های روز، می‌توان سایتی تعاملی، جذاب و کارآمد ایجاد کرد که هم برای دانش‌آموزان و هم برای پژوهشگران ارزشمند باشد.
در نهایت، این پروژه، یک پل ارتباطی موثر بین علم و فناوری است، و می‌تواند به ارتقاء سطح آموزش و پژوهش در حوزه شیمی و علوم مرتبط کمک کند. پس، با برنامه‌ریزی دقیق، طراحی حرفه‌ای و توسعه مستمر، می‌توان سایتی ساخت که در آینده نقش مهمی در ارتقاء دانش و فهم عمومی ایفا کند.
مشاهده بيشتر